1. Gateway of India and Elephanta Caves
Start your shore excursion at the Gateway of India, Mumbai’s iconic arch by the Arabian Sea. This historic landmark, built in 1924, is just minutes from the cruise terminal, making it a perfect first stop. From here, take a short ferry ride to the Elephanta Caves, a UNESCO World Heritage Site featuring ancient rock-cut temples dedicated to Lord Shiva. This excursion combines history and adventure, ideal for cruise passengers with a few hours to spare.
- Why Visit: Iconic landmark, ancient caves, scenic ferry ride
Tip: Book a guided tour to skip the ferry queues and learn about the caves’ history.
2.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j Terminus (CSMT) and Heritage Walk
Explore Mumbai’s architectural gem, the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j Terminus, a UNESCO World Heritage Site known for its stunning Victorian Gothic design. Pair this with a guided heritage walk through South Mumbai’s Fort area, where you’ll see colonial-era buildings like the Bombay High Court and Flora Fountain. This excursion is perfect for history buffs and fits well within a cruise schedule.
- Why Visit: Architectural splendor, colonial history
Tip: Wear comfortable shoes for the walking tour and bring a camera for CSMT’s intricate details.
3. Haji Ali Dargah and Siddhivinayak Temple
Experience Mumbai’s spiritual side with a visit to the Haji Ali Dargah, a 15th-century mosque on an islet accessible by a causeway, followed by the Siddhivinayak Temple, a 200-year-old shrine dedicated to Lord Ganesha. This shore excursion offers a glimpse into Mumbai’s religious diversity and is easily accessible from the cruise port.
- Why Visit: Spiritual significance, cultural immersion
Tip: Check tide times for Haji Ali to ensure causeway access, and dress modestly for both sites.
4. Marine Drive and Bandra-Worli Sea Link
Enjoy a scenic drive along Marine Drive, dubbed the “Queen’s Necklace” for its sparkling evening lights, and cross the iconic Bandra-Worli Sea Link, a modern engineering marvel. This excursion offers stunning views of Mumbai’s coastline and skyline, perfect for cruise passengers seeking a relaxed yet visually spectacular tour.
- Why Visit: Scenic beauty, modern architecture
Tip: Stop at Worli Sea Face for panoramic photos of the sea link.
5. Juhu Beach and Bollywood Experience
For a taste of Mumbai’s vibrant local culture, head to Juhu Beach, where you can enjoy street food like pav bhaji and soak in the lively atmosphere. Pair this with a Bollywood-themed excursion, including a visit to a film studio (if time permits) or a stop at Bandra’s Bollywood hotspots like celebrity homes or cafes. This tour is ideal for cruise passengers wanting a mix of leisure and Mumbai’s cinematic charm.
- Why Visit: Local vibe, Bollywood glamour
Tip: Try authentic street food from trusted vendors at Juhu Beach.

Tips for a Memorable Mumbai Darshan Shore Excursion
- Book Through Your Cruise Line or Trusted Operators: Ensure reliability and timely return to the ship by booking with reputable providers.
- Start Early: Most cruise schedules allow for a 7–8 AM start, maximizing your sightseeing time.
- Stay Hydrated: Mumbai’s humid climate calls for carrying water and sunscreen.
- Check Visa Requirements: Ensure you have the necessary Indian visa or e-visa before disembarking.
- Plan for Traffic: Mumbai’s roads can be busy, so choose excursions with efficient routes to avoid delays.
